javascript 学习之旅 (2)

下面我来详细讲解“Javascript 学习之旅(2)”的完整攻略。

1. 学习目标

本篇攻略主要介绍Javascript中的基础知识,包括基本语法、变量、数据类型、运算符、语句等内容。通过本篇攻略的学习,你将了解如下内容:

  • Javascript的语法结构和基础知识
  • Javascript中的变量和数据类型
  • Javascript中的运算符和语句
  • 熟悉Javascript常用的方法和属性

2. 学习步骤

(1)学习语法结构和基础知识

学习Javascript的第一步就是了解它的基础知识和语法结构。你可以通过阅读相关教程、参加相关课程等形式来进行学习。

在学习过程中,建议你多动手编写代码,在练习中掌握Javascript的基本语法规则,包括变量声明、函数定义、运算符、流程控制语句等。例如,下面是一个简单的Javascript程序:

var a = 1;
var b = 2;
var c = a + b;
alert(c);

以上程序的功能是将变量a和变量b相加,然后将结果弹出一个提示框。

(2)学习变量和数据类型

在Javascript中,声明一个变量必须使用关键字var,并且可以设定变量的初始值。Javascript中的数据类型包括字符串、数字、布尔值、数组、对象等。你可以通过阅读相关文档,学习如何声明变量和使用不同的数据类型。

例如,下面是一个演示如何使用不同数据类型的代码示例:

var str = "hello world";
var num = 123;
var bool = true;
var arr = [1,2,3];
var obj = {name: '张三', age: 18};

以上示例中,声明了一个字符串类型的变量,一个数字类型的变量,一个布尔类型的变量,一个数组类型的变量和一个对象类型的变量。

(3)学习运算符和语句

在Javascript中,运算符包括算术运算符、逻辑运算符、比较运算符等。运算符可以对变量进行各种运算处理,例如,进行加、减、乘、除等计算。

在Javascript中,语句包括条件语句、循环语句、函数等。语句可以控制程序的流程,实现各种复杂的操作。

例如,下面是一个演示如何使用运算符和语句的代码示例:

var a = 1;
var b = 2;
var c = a + b;
if (c === 3) {
  alert("c等于3");
} else if (c > 3) {
  alert("c大于3");
} else {
  alert("c小于3");
}
for (var i = 0; i < arr.length; i++) {
  console.log(arr[i]);
}
function sum(a, b) {
  return a + b;
}

以上示例中,使用了加法运算符计算变量a和变量b的和,使用条件语句判断变量c的大小关系,使用循环语句输出数组arr的元素值,还定义了一个计算两个数相加的函数。

3. 示例说明

示例1:打印数组所有元素

下面是一个打印数组所有元素的示例:

var arr = [1, 2, 3];
for (var i = 0; i < arr.length; i++) {
    console.log(arr[i]);
}

以上代码使用for循环语句遍历数组,并使用console.log()方法打印数组的每个元素。

示例2:计算两个数相加

下面是一个计算两个数相加的示例:

function sum(a, b) {
    return a + b;
}
var result = sum(2, 3);
console.log(result);

以上代码定义了一个函数sum,接收两个参数a和b,并返回它们的和。在主程序中,调用sum函数计算两个数字相加并打印结果。

4. 总结

本篇攻略主要介绍了Javascript的基础知识,包括语法结构、变量、数据类型、运算符和语句等内容,并提供了两个示例说明帮助你更好地理解和应用这些知识点。希望你通过本篇攻略的学习,能够对Javascript有更深入的认识,并掌握基础知识,打下坚实的基础,为学习更高级的Javascript技术打下良好的基础。

本站文章如无特殊说明,均为本站原创,如若转载,请注明出处:javascript 学习之旅 (2) - Python技术站

(0)
上一篇 2023年5月18日
下一篇 2023年5月18日

相关文章

  • js正则表达式replace替换变量方法

    JS正则表达式replace替换变量方法是一种常见的字符串替换方式。可以利用正则表达式匹配字符串中需要替换的部分,并将其替换为新的内容。下面详细讲解这种方法的步骤和示例。 1. 替换方法的语法 JS中正则表达式replace替换变量方法的语法如下: str.replace(regexp|substr, newSubStr|function) 其中, str …

    JavaScript 2023年6月10日
    00
  • 实例解析Array和String方法

    实例解析Array和String方法 在 JavaScript 开发中,使用 Array 和 String 是非常常见的。为了更好的掌握这两个数据类型,了解其方法使用是非常必要的。本文将会讲解 Array 和 String 常用的方法以及使用示例。 Array方法 push 语法:arrayObject.push(newelement1,newelement…

    JavaScript 2023年6月10日
    00
  • javascript针对DOM的应用分析(五)

    “javascript针对DOM的应用分析(五)”是一篇关于Javascript框架的技术分析文章,主要讲解了如何使用Javascript操作DOM(Document Object Model)。以下是完整攻略。 一、DOM是什么 DOM是文档对象模型(Document Object Model)的缩写,用于描述HTML和XML文档的程序接口。通过 DOM,…

    JavaScript 2023年6月10日
    00
  • JS中判断字符串存在和非空的方法

    JS中可以使用多种方法来判断字符串的存在和非空,以下是一些常见的方法和用法: 1. 使用typeof方法判断 可以使用typeof方法来判断字符串是否存在和非空。如果一个字符串存在,那么typeof将返回”string”,否则将返回undefined。可以将这个值与”string”进行比较来确定字符串是否存在。 var str1; if (typeof st…

    JavaScript 2023年5月28日
    00
  • JavaScript给url网址进行encode编码的方法

    当我们需要将参数或者参数中的某些特殊字符放在URL中时,为了保证URL的正确性和完整性,我们需要对URL进行编码。 JavaScript中提供了编码URL的方法:encodeURIComponent(),它可以将字符串编码成URL中合法的格式。下面是详细攻略: 1. 使用encodeURIComponent()进行编码 JavaScript中的encodeU…

    JavaScript 2023年5月20日
    00
  • 微信小程序开发之animation循环动画实现的让云朵飘效果

    下面是关于“微信小程序开发之animation循环动画实现的让云朵飘效果”的完整攻略: 1. 了解animation动画 在微信小程序中,我们可以使用animation来创建动画效果。animation可以制作基本的动画类型,如平移、旋转、缩放、透明度等。通过设置animation实例的属性和调用animation的方法,来控制动画的实现。 2. 实现云朵飘…

    JavaScript 2023年6月11日
    00
  • Actionscript与javascript交互实例程序(修改)

    针对“Actionscript与javascript交互实例程序(修改)”这一文章,我将分为以下几个部分进行详细讲解: 文章介绍 修改内容说明 ActionScript与JavaScript交互示例 综合示例程序 总结 1. 文章介绍 该篇文章主要介绍了ActionScript与JavaScript相互交互的实现方式,通过ExternalInterface类…

    JavaScript 2023年5月27日
    00
  • javascript跳转与返回和刷新页面的实例代码

    下面我来给大家详细讲解一下“JavaScript跳转与返回和刷新页面的实例代码”的攻略。 一、JavaScript跳转页面 要实现JS跳转页面,可以使用 window.location 对象,可以修改当前页面的 URL 地址,还可以打开新的页面。下面是实现JS跳转页面的示例代码: // 跳转到百度首页 window.location.href = &quot…

    JavaScript 2023年6月11日
    00
合作推广
合作推广
分享本页
返回顶部